Função de retorno de chamada CryptXmlDllCreateKey (cryptxml.h)

A função CryptXmlDllCreateKey analisa o elemento KeyValue e cria uma API de Criptografia: identificador de chave BCrypt de Última Geração (CNG) para verificar uma assinatura.

Sintaxe

CryptXmlDllCreateKey Cryptxmldllcreatekey;

HRESULT Cryptxmldllcreatekey(
  [in]  const CRYPT_XML_BLOB *pEncoded,
  [out] BCRYPT_KEY_HANDLE *phKey
)
{...}

Parâmetros

[in] pEncoded

Um ponteiro para uma estrutura CRYPT_XML_BLOB que contém o elemento KeyValue .

[out] phKey

Um ponteiro para uma variável BCRYPT_KEY_HANDLE que recebe o identificador da chave usada para verificar a assinatura.

Quando CryptXML terminar de usar a chave, CryptXML a liberará chamando a função BCryptDestroyKey .

Retornar valor

Se a função for bem-sucedida, a função retornará zero.

Se a função falhar, ela retornará um valor HRESULT que indica o erro.

Requisitos

Requisito Valor
Cliente mínimo com suporte Windows 7 [somente aplicativos da área de trabalho]
Servidor mínimo com suporte Windows Server 2008 R2 [somente aplicativos da área de trabalho]
Plataforma de Destino Windows
Cabeçalho cryptxml.h